1
0
mirror of https://github.com/emilk/egui.git synced 2026-06-27 23:13:13 -04:00
This commit is contained in:
Konkitoman
2023-11-08 07:47:43 +02:00
parent 37e42d1608
commit 04fbafd4ec

View File

@@ -1,5 +1,4 @@
use egui::TexturesDelta;
use egui::{ViewportId, ViewportIdPair};
use wasm_bindgen::JsValue;
use crate::{epi, App};
@@ -179,11 +178,9 @@ impl AppRunner {
let canvas_size = super::canvas_size_in_points(self.canvas_id());
let raw_input = self.input.new_frame(canvas_size);
let full_output = self
.egui_ctx
.run(raw_input, ViewportIdPair::ROOT, |egui_ctx| {
self.app.update(egui_ctx, &mut self.frame);
});
let full_output = self.egui_ctx.run(raw_input, |egui_ctx| {
self.app.update(egui_ctx, &mut self.frame);
});
let egui::FullOutput {
platform_output,
textures_delta,
@@ -193,7 +190,7 @@ impl AppRunner {
self.handle_platform_output(platform_output);
self.textures_delta.append(textures_delta);
let clipped_primitives = self.egui_ctx.tessellate(shapes, ViewportId::ROOT);
let clipped_primitives = self.egui_ctx.tessellate(shapes);
{
let app_output = self.frame.take_app_output();